Aberdeen

League Cup - 1 loss

Sc Cup - 1 draw 2 losses

League - 6 draws, 3 losses

Berwick

Coca Cola (League) Cup - 1 loss

Bells (challenge) Cup) - 1 loss

Elgin

no competitive fixtures against Elgin so no wins or losses !

of the other teams people have mentioned ......

Morton - 8 games in Div1 - 5 wins, 2 losses, 1 draw

Partick - 4 in Div2 - 3 wins, 1 loss. 4 in Div1 - 1 win, 3 losses. 1 CIS Cup win, 4 Sc Cup, 2 draws, 2 losses

Queens Park - 12 in Div3 - 7 wins, 3 draws, 2 losses. 1 Sc Cup win, 1 CIS Cup loss

Peterhead - 1 CIS Cup win, 1 Bells Cup win

Gretna - 1 Bells cup win

Record against DUFC ..... pretty even to be fair !

97/98 - Scottish Cup: 1 draw at Tannadice, 1 extra time loss at Caledonian Stadium

04/05 - SPL: 2 draws, 2 losses

05/06 - SPL: 2 draws, 2 wins / League Cup: 1 win

06/07 - SPL: 2 draws, 1 win, 1 loss / Scottish Cup: 1 win

P16  W5  L4  D7  F17  A19
